服务器并行存储是一种高效的数据存储技术,它通过将数据分散存储在多个存储节点上,并利用并行处理技术来提高数据处理速度和效率,以下是对服务器并行存储的详细解释:
服务器并行存储是指将数据以并行的方式分布在多个存储设备或节点上,通过同时使用多种计算资源对数据进行处理和存储的技术,其核心原理是将数据分割成多个片段,每个片段被分配到不同的存储节点上进行并行处理,从而实现数据的快速读写和高效管理。
1、存储节点:负责存储数据并提供访问接口,通常由处理器、内存、磁盘阵列等硬件组成。
2、控制节点:负责整个存储系统的管理,包括数据分配、负载均衡、故障检测与恢复等。
3、存储网络:连接控制节点和存储节点,负责数据传输和通信,常用的技术有光纤通道、以太网等。
4、用户接口:提供对存储系统的访问接口,如文件系统、块设备、对象存储等。
1、数据分布策略:包括随机分布、哈希分布、范围分布和网格分布等,用于将数据均匀分配到各个存储节点上。
2、负载均衡技术:通过动态调整数据在各个节点上的分布,确保系统资源的合理利用。
3、数据复制与冗余技术:用于保证数据的安全性和可靠性,如RAID技术、数据镜像等。
4、并行文件系统:支持并行计算环境的文件系统,具有高可扩展性和高性能。
5、并行存储访问协议:在并行计算环境中,多个处理单元同时对存储设备进行访问和操作的协议。
1、硬件优化:采用高性能的服务器、存储设备和网络设备,提高存储系统的整体性能。
2、软件算法优化:优化并行存储系统的性能,包括算法优化、数据布局优化和通信优化等。
3、智能缓存策略:将热数据存储在高速缓存中,降低访问延迟。
1、科学计算:用于基因测序、气象预测、金融分析等领域。
2、大数据分析:适用于处理大规模数据集,提高数据处理速度和效率。
3、人工智能:为AI模型训练和推理提供高性能的存储解决方案。
4、云计算:作为云服务提供商的基础设施,支持大规模数据存储和处理。
1、Q1:什么是服务器并行存储?
A1:服务器并行存储是一种将数据分散存储在多个存储设备或节点上,并通过并行处理技术来提高数据处理速度和效率的存储方式。
2、Q2:服务器并行存储有哪些优势?
A2:服务器并行存储的优势包括提高数据处理速度和效率、增强系统可靠性、实现资源共享、优化成本管理以及支持横向扩展等。
服务器并行存储是一种高效、可靠的数据存储技术,广泛应用于科学计算、大数据分析、人工智能等领域,随着技术的不断发展,服务器并行存储将继续发挥重要作用,为各行业提供更加强大的数据支持。